
STATE NEWSPAPER CONGRATULATES GAMECOCKS FOR ALSO BEING AVERAGE
They say “misery loves company.” But for The State newspaper, it’s more like “mediocrity loves company.”
The State Media Company — the newspaper’s advertising arm — ran a quarter-page ad this week congratulating the Gamecocks for “recording at least a .500 record in all three sports in the same season.”
Yes… they actually praised South Carolina’s football, basketball and baseball teams for being average. And that’s pretty funny given that The State newspaper is just barely clinging to average itself.
Even better, The State added this gem: “This is the first time this feat has been achieved since becoming a member of the Southeastern Conference. Go Gamecocks!”
For those of you keeping track, South Carolina joined the SEC in 1991. That’s 18 years.
Now, I’m not sure if the ad was meant to be sarcastic, but Gamecock fans will probably tell you someone at The State should be fired. Seriously… what moron thought this was a good idea?
